Governor's statement following the U.S. Senate's approval of supplemental
appropriations request


"The U.S. Senate Appropriations Committee today approved significant funds
for Louisiana's recovery, including an additional $4.2 billion in CDBG
housing funds dedicated to our state. I was privileged to be present in the
committee room when the President's supplement appropriations request was
considered and approved.

"Today's action, if approved by both houses of Congress, will allow us to
fully fund our housing program and will enable our citizens to rebuild,
repair or relocate. Today's action means that our families and communities
are much closer to having the assistance they desperately need to begin
restoring their homes and communities.

"In addition to funding our housing plan, the committee provided additional
funds for: levee construction and repair; assistance to help our colleges
and universities affected by the storms; funds to help our ports, our
farmers and our vital Gulf fisheries recover; and, funds for demonstration
projects for so-called 'Katrina cottages'.
